CopyAI Pricing

Does CopyAI’s pricing fit your budget?

CopyAI pricing features clear, tiered plans with specific costs, allowing you to easily understand their cost structure and find a suitable option for your content needs.

Plan Price & Features
Free Plan $0 per month
• 2,000 words per month
• 1 user seat
• 90+ copywriting tools
• Unlimited projects
• 7-day Pro Plan trial
Pro Plan $49/month or $36/month (billed annually)
• Unlimited chat words
• Up to 5 user seats
• All latest LLMs
• Multilingual support (25+)
• Blog Wizard tool
Advanced Plan $249/month or $186/month (billed annually)
• All Pro features
• Up to 5 seats
• 2,000 workflow credits
• 15+ marketing/sales workflows
• Workflow Builder access
Enterprise/Scale Custom pricing (from $249-$4,000/month)
• 20-200 user seats
• High workflow credits
• Private Infobase
• SSO & Infosec review
• Dedicated account manager

1. Jasper AI

Need extensive long-form content and SEO tools?

Jasper AI excels for generating in-depth blog posts, articles, and even books, integrating with SEO tools like Surfer SEO. From my competitive analysis, Jasper offers superior long-form content capabilities for marketers producing content at scale, though it typically starts at a higher price point.

Choose Jasper when your primary need is comprehensive long-form content creation and robust SEO integration.

2. Writesonic

Focused on e-commerce product descriptions or many languages?

Writesonic is a strong alternative if your business relies heavily on e-commerce product descriptions or requires content generation in a broader array of languages. What I found comparing options is that Writesonic excels for e-commerce and multi-language support, often at a lower initial cost than CopyAI.

Opt for Writesonic if your content needs are primarily e-commerce focused or require extensive language options.

3. Article Forge

Want full SEO articles with minimal effort?

Article Forge specializes in generating complete, SEO-optimized long articles with images and videos, capable of direct WordPress posting. From my analysis, Article Forge automates full, SEO-ready article creation, making it a budget-friendly alternative for high-volume article production.

Choose Article Forge if your main goal is creating and publishing complete SEO-optimized articles directly to WordPress.

4. Copysmith

Prioritizing consistently human-like text quality?

Copysmith is often seen as a strong contender for consistently producing very high-quality, human-like text across various content types. Alternative-wise, Copysmith provides high-quality human-like text generation that might align better with your workflow or specific integration needs.

Consider Copysmith if generating exceptionally human-like text is your top priority across different content formats.
